Regarding ALEO (IOU)

brief introduction
Aleo is a pioneering developer platform that enables users to build private, scalable, and cost-effective applications. Through zero knowledge encryption, it moves smart contract execution off chain, creating a private decentralized application that can process thousands of transactions per second. Aleo combines the flexibility of Ethereum with a more efficient architecture, reducing the need for miners to rerun each transaction and focusing solely on verification.
founder
The Aleo project was officially established in 2019 by Howard Wu, Michael Beller, Collin Chin, and Raymond Chu. The team is composed of world-class cryptographers, engineers, designers, and operators from companies such as Google, Amazon, and Facebook, as well as research universities such as the University of California, Berkeley, Johns Hopkins University, New York University, and Cornell University.
Aleo’s core founder Howard Wu received a Bachelor’s degree in Applied Mathematics and a Bachelor’s degree in Computer Science from the University of California, Berkeley. At Berkeley, Howard also helped establish one of the top university blockchain clubs. After graduation, Howard worked at Google for a year, researching distributed systems, Aleo ASIC, Maxsayss, or ZKtaoma, but soon returned to Berkeley to pursue a master’s degree in electrical engineering and computer science, focusing on zero knowledge proofs.
He has contributed to the cryptographic libraries used for Ethereum and Zcash, collaborated closely with many renowned scholars from Berkeley, Cornell, and other institutions on zero knowledge proof research, and co authored the groundbreaking paper “Zexe: Implementing Decentralized Private Computing”. He is also a managing partner of DeKrypt Capital.
Inflation and mining rewards
In addition to the tokens initially allocated to the Aleo team, early supporters, and community members, a portion will be retained for wider distribution after the mainnet launch. The purpose of expanding allocation this time is to further decentralize governance, improve the standards of the open source community, and comply with relevant legal frameworks.
Early adopters of the internet will benefit from Aleo’s inflation plan, which aims to rapidly enhance network security. To achieve this goal, we implemented a relatively high initial inflation rate, followed by two halvings in the first decade. This method ensures both network security and economic stability.

Aleo chose to adopt a variant of proof of work instead of alternative consensus mechanisms such as proof of stake, which has significant advantages in wider token allocation, especially in the early stages of network development. From the beginning, the Aleo network will operate without heavily relying on the Aleo core team, emphasizing decentralized control. This approach follows the established path of other blockchain platforms successfully achieving scalability and strong network security.
It is worth noting that our model is slightly different from traditional proof of work systems, but the differences are significant. In necessary proof of work frameworks like concise proof of work, the generated proofs are truly useful computations, rather than arbitrary puzzles designed solely for selecting winning miners. Therefore, in this situation, the incremental energy consumption associated with mining activities is significantly reduced, as the work performed is essentially necessary for verifying state changes.
